Corolla gets awd for 2023
« on: June 01, 2022, 12:04:11 pm »
https://www.autotrader.ca/editorial/20220601/2023-toyota-corolla-introduces-new-hybrid-awd-model/

After the hybrid drivetrain, the 'Rolla now grabs the Prius' e-AWD setup (electric motor at the rear) to gain a low-speed awd setup. Hopefully the cable won't rust here.

Re: Corolla gets awd for 2023
« Reply #7 on: October 18, 2022, 10:17:03 am »
https://www.autotrader.ca/editorial/20220601/2023-toyota-corolla-introduces-new-hybrid-awd-model/

After the hybrid drivetrain, the 'Rolla now grabs the Prius' e-AWD setup (electric motor at the rear) to gain a low-speed awd setup. Hopefully the cable won't rust here.

As it would appear, the AWD rolla will use an improved version of Prius's AWD, now with a beefed up rear motor, with up to 40 hp output according to this reviewer:
 https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=yAcuDtjmD-s
(AoA)

IIRC the Prius's rear motor power was in single digits. This one is getting close to a proper AWD performance.
